Interface IWMDRMSecurity

[O recurso associado a esta página, Windows Media Format 11 SDK, é um recurso herdado. Ele foi substituído por Leitor de Origem e Gravador de Coletor. O Leitor de Origem e o Gravador de Coletor foram otimizados para Windows 10 e Windows 11. A Microsoft recomenda fortemente que o novo código use o Leitor de Origem e o Gravador de Coletor em vez do SDK do Windows Media Format 11, quando possível. A Microsoft sugere que o código existente que usa as APIs herdadas seja reescrito para usar as novas APIs, se possível.]

A interface IWMDRMSecurity gerencia uma variedade de informações relacionadas à segurança para o computador cliente e o subsistema DRM (gerenciamento de direitos digitais).

Para obter uma instância dessa interface, chame IWMDRMProvider::CreateObject. Passe IID_IWMDRMSecurity como o parâmetro riid .

Membros

A interface IWMDRMSecurity herda de IWMDRMEventGenerator. IWMDRMSecurity também tem estes tipos de membros:

Métodos

A interface IWMDRMSecurity tem esses métodos.

Método Descrição
CheckCertForRevocation Determina se um certificado foi revogado.
GetContentEnablersForRevocations Recupera interfaces do habilitador de conteúdo que permitem a renovação de componentes com base em certificados revogados.
GetContentEnablersFromHashes Recupera interfaces do habilitador de conteúdo que permitem a renovação de componentes com base em certificados com hash.
GetMachineCertificate Recupera o certificado do computador do subsistema DRM no computador cliente.
GetRevocationData Recupera uma lista de revogação de certificados do repositório local.
GetRevocationDataVersion Recupera o número de versão de uma lista de revogação de certificados no repositório local.
GetSecurityVersion Recupera a versão do subsistema DRM no computador cliente.
PerformSecurityUpdate Inicia uma atualização de segurança para o subsistema DRM no computador cliente.
SetRevocationData Define uma lista de revogação de certificados no repositório local.

Confira também

Exemplo de individualização de DRM

Interfaces

IWMDRMEventGenerator